Commissioning the MCCB

6.1

General procedures

– Make sure that the power connections to the circuit breaker terminals are tight
– Make adjustments to the trip unit protection functions [LSIG].
– Make sure that voltage of the auxiliary circuits is between 85% and 110% of the rated voltage
– To avoid temperature rises, make sure that there is suffi cient air exchange in the installation area
– Also perform the inspections indicated in the following table.
